Optical Office Staff Jobs in Durham, NH

An Optical Office Staff plays a crucial role in the optometry industry by handling numerous administrative and customer service tasks that contribute to a smooth functioning of an optical clinic or store. They are typically responsible for greeting and checking in patients, scheduling appointments, maintaining patient records, processing payments, and assisting with eye wear sales and fittings. They may also be tasked with performing preliminary eye tests and communicating with insurance companies. A strong understanding of optometry terminology, excellent communication skills, and attention to detail are imperative for this role.

Before becoming an Optical Office Staff, an individual might have held positions such as Receptionist, Customer Service Representative, or Administrative Assistant. To excel as an Optical Office Staff, one should possess certifications in medical billing and coding or optometric assistant certification, although requirements may vary depending on the specific role and employer. Other valuable skills include proficiency with office software, the ability to multitask efficiently, and a friendly and professional demeanor. Experience in the healthcare field, particularly in an optometry or ophthalmology setting, can be advantageous.
